Russia’s security chief, Cuba’s president discuss bilateral cooperation

Cuban President Miguel Diaz-Canel has received Russian Security Council Secretary Nikolai Patrushev to discuss bilateral cooperation, including issues about security and the economy, the Russian Security Council said.
The meeting took place on Monday in Havana, according to the statement.
“(Diaz-Canel and Patrushev) discussed issues about the practical interaction between Russia and Cuba in the fields of security, the economy, and culture,” the statement read.
It added that the two officials reaffirmed that “Russia and Cuba are reliable allies who are actively developing multifaceted cooperation preserving the continuity of intent to deepen bilateral ties.”
Earlier in February, Russia and Cuba agreed to further develop trade, economic, and investment cooperation, in particular, through the work of the Intergovernmental Trade Commission,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ov said during his visit to Cuba.
Cuban Foreign Minister Bruno Rodriguez is expected to pay a visit to Russia in 2024 at Moscow’s invitation.
